Message type: E = Error
Message class: CM_PIQ_SDPRICELIST - Message Class for Price List
Message number: 020
Message text: Report executed

- Report executed ?The SAP error message CM_PIQ_SDPRICELIST020 typically relates to issues encountered during the execution of a report that deals with pricing lists in the Sales and Distribution (SD) module. This error can arise due to various reasons, including configuration issues, missing data, or incorrect parameters.
Cause:
- Missing or Incorrect Data: The pricing conditions or master data (like customer or material master) may not be set up correctly.
- Configuration Issues: The pricing procedure may not be configured properly in the system.
- Authorization Issues: The user executing the report may not have the necessary authorizations to access certain data.
- Technical Issues: There could be a problem with the underlying database or the report itself.
Solution:
- Check Master Data: Ensure that all relevant master data (customers, materials, pricing conditions) is correctly maintained in the system.
- Review Pricing Procedure: Verify that the pricing procedure is correctly configured and that all necessary condition types are included.
- Authorization Check: Ensure that the user has the appropriate authorizations to execute the report and access the required data.
- Debugging: If you have access to technical resources, consider debugging the report to identify the exact point of failure.
- Consult Documentation: Review SAP documentation or notes related to the specific error message for additional insights or patches.
-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to SAP support for assistance, providing them with the error details and any relevant logs.
